Breaking Down The Concept Of Squatter’s Rights

Squatter’s rights, also known as adverse possession, is a fascinating legal principle where someone can claim ownership of land simply by occupying it over time, without the original owner’s consent. This concept might seem counterintuitive initially—after all, taking legal ownership of property that isn’t yours initially sounds quite extreme! However, this principle is supported by specific legal conditions and requirements.

Historical Context

Squatter’s rights have deep historical roots. Originating long ago, the principle was based on the idea that land should not remain idle. This notion was eventually incorporated into English common law and has been adopted in many places, including the United States. The rationale behind squatter’s rights is practical: it promotes the efficient use of land and helps clarify property ownership, particularly when land has been occupied for an extended period without dispute.

Legal Criteria

To claim property under squatter’s rights, certain criteria must be met, which can vary by location. First, the squatter must physically live on and use the property as if they owned it, which might involve activities like building renovations or farming. Their occupation of the land must be open and obvious enough that a reasonable property owner would notice.

Furthermore, the squatter must have exclusive use of the land—this means not sharing it with others, including the original owner. Crucially, they must also continuously occupy the land for a specific period, typically ranging from five to twenty years, depending on local laws.

Claiming property through adverse possession isn’t straightforward. After the required time has elapsed, the squatter must formally assert ownership through legal channels, which can be challenging if the original owner contests the claim. The court then evaluates whether the squatter has satisfied all legal requirements.

If the court rules in favor of the squatter, they can legally acquire the land. Conversely, if the court supports the original owner, the squatter may be evicted and possibly liable for damages or back rent.

Public Perception

Recently, there’s been a rise in individuals claiming properties through squatter’s rights, sparking debate over whether this law should continue. Critics argue that it could be abused, potentially enabling people to take over properties unlawfully. In contrast, proponents believe squatter’s rights serve a valuable purpose, particularly in cases where property owners neglect or abandon their land, thus allowing others who are ready to develop and utilize the land productively to legally claim it.

In summary, squatter’s rights showcase how historical concepts can still significantly impact modern society. They provide opportunities for some by allowing them to claim unused land, but they also pose challenges for property owners. Understanding the legal framework of property rights helps individuals navigate complex property issues.
